Red de conocimiento informático - Aprendizaje de código fuente - Código fuente de la fórmula del índice de escala de ondas de Wenhua

Código fuente de la fórmula del índice de escala de ondas de Wenhua

Alta: = 10;

Baja: = 10;

Selección alta: = 1;

Selección baja: = 1;

Medidor de onda 1: = 0;

Medidor de onda 2:= 1;

PURC:=CONST(FINDHIGH(H, 0, punto alto * 10, selección de punto alto));

PLZ: = CONST(barras últimas(PURC = H)) 1;

Top x: = const (if (plz = 1, h, ref (h , plz-1 ));

QQT:=CONST(FINDLOW(L, 0, punto bajo*10, selección de punto bajo));

PLL:= CONST(últimas barras (QQT = L )) 1;

X baja: = const (if (PLL = 1, l, ref (l, PLL-1)));

Línea de tracción ( H, O, L, C);

Vértice: x superior, coloreado;

Abajo: x inferior, coloreado;

Volatilidad: =100 *(Superior (Superior ; PLZ,1,-1);

BPURC:=CONST(FINDHIGH(H,0,(IF(regla de onda 1 gt;0,regla de onda 1,if (por favor

BPLZ:= CONST(barras últimas(b purc = H)) 1;

BQQT:=CONST(FINDLOW(L, 0, (IF(regla de onda 1 gt; 0, regla de onda 1, si ( por favor

BPLL:= CONST(barras últimas(BQQT = L)) 1;

BLC1: = const (encontrar alto (h, 0, (if(regla de onda 1 gt; 0, medidor de ondas 1, if (plz

bl C2: = CONST(barras últimas(b purc = H)) 1;

BLC top x: = const (if ( bplz = 1, h, ref (h, bplz-1));

BLC3: =CONST(FINDLOW(L, 0, (IF(regla de onda 1 >; 0, regla de onda 1, si (por favor

B6 C4: = CONST(barras ultimas(BQQT = L)) 1;

BLC bajo x: = const (if (bpll = 1, l, ref (l, bpll- 1));

Base:=IF(Volatilidad

BLCX:=IF(Volatilidad

BLCZ:=(Vértice-Vértice)* (si(PLL >PLZ,1,-1);

b 618:= BASE (BLCZ * 0.618) COLOR ROJO, LÍNEA DE PUNTOS

b382:= BASE (BLCZ * 0.382) COLOR ROJO, LÍNEA DE PUNTOS

B05:=BASE (BLCZ*0.5)COLORROJO,LÍNEA DE PUNTOS

b809:=BASE (BLCZ*0.809)COLORR

ED, LÍNEA DE PUNTOS

b 191:= BASE (BLCZ * 0.191)COLOR, LÍNEA DE PUNTOS

b 100:= BASE (BLCZ * 1)COLOR;

b200 := BASE (BLCZ * 2)COLOR;

b 11:= BASE (BLCZ * 1.191)COLOR;

b 12:= BASE (BLCZ * 1.382)COLOR;

p>

b 13:= BASE (BLCZ * 1.5)COLOR;

b 14:= BASE (BLCZ * 1.618)COLOR;

b 15 := BASE (BLCZ * 1.809)COLOR ROJO;

BZ 1:= BASE (BLCZ * 0.236)COLOR ROJO;

BZ2:= BASE (BLCZ * 1.236)COLOR ROJO;

BZ3 := BASE (BLCZ * 2.236)COLOR ROJO;

b 11B:= BASE (BLCZ * 2.191)COLOR ROJO;

b 12B:= BASE (BLCZ * 2.382) )COLOR;

p>

b 13B:= BASE (BLCZ * 2.5)COLOR;

b 14B:= BASE (BLCZ * 2.618)COLOR;

b 15B:= BASE (BLCZ * 2.809)COLOR ROJO;

b300:= BASE (BLCZ * 3)COLOR ROJO;

XZDD:= IF(PLL gt;PLZ, BPLL, BPLZ);

Línea de adhesión (CURRBARSCOUNT=XZDD, BASE, B300, 0, 0), el color es rojo

DRAWTEXT (CURRBARSCOUNT=XZDD, B05, '-0.500; ') coloreado;

DRAWTEXT(CURRBARSCOUNT=XZDD, BASE, '-BASE ')COLORRED;

DRAWTEXT(CURRBARSCOUNT=XZDD, B618, '-0.618 ')coloreado;

DRAWTEXT(CURRBARSCOUNT= XZDD, B809, '-0.809 ');

DRAWTEXT(CURRBARSCOUNT=XZDD, B382, '-0.382 ')coloreado;

DRAWTEXT( CURRBARSCOUNT=XZDD, B191,'- 0.191 ')de color;

DRAWTEXT(CURRBARSCOUNT=XZDD, B100, '-1.000 ')de color;

DRAWTEXT(CURRBARSCOUNT=XZDD, B11, B11, '-1.191 ')de color;

DRAWTEXT(CURRBARSCOUNT=XZDD, B12, '-1.382 ')de color;

DRAWTEXT(CURRBARSCOUNT=XZDD, B13, '-1.500 ')de color ;

SORTEO

XT(CURRBARSCOUNT=XZDD, B14, '-1.618 ')de color;

DRAWTEXT(CURRBARSCOUNT=XZDD, B15, '-1.809 ')de color;

DRAWTEXT(CURRBARSCOUNT=XZDD, B15, '-1.809 ')de color;

DRAWTEXT(CURRBARSCOUNT=XZDD, B200, '-2.000 ')de color;

DRAWTEXT(CURRBARSCOUNT=XZDD, B11B, '-2.191 ')de color;

DRAWTEXT(CURRBARSCOUNT=XZDD, B12B, '-2.382 ' )de color;

DRAWTEXT(CURRBARSCOUNT=XZDD, B13B, '-2.500 ')de color;

DRAWTEXT(CURRBARSCOUNT=XZDD, B14B, '-2.618 ')de color;

DRAWTEXT(CURRBARSCOUNT=XZDD, B15B, '-2.809 ')de color;

DRAWTEXT(CURRBARSCOUNT=XZDD, B300, '-3.000 ')de color;

DRAWTEXT( CURRBARSCOUNT=XZDD, BZ1, '-0.236 ')de color;

DRAWTEXT(CURRBARSCOUNT=XZDD, BZ2, '-1.236 ')de color;'-2.236 ')de color;

QADQ := SI(PLL gt; PLZ, PLL, PLZ);

QADH:= SI(PLL gt; PLZ, PLZ, PLL) ;

qhl 1:= SI(PLL gt;PLZ,L,H);

qh L2:= IF(PLL gt;PLZ,H,L);

DRAWLINE(CURRBARSCOUNT=QADQ,QHL1,CURRBARSCOUNT=QADH ,QHL2,0)de color;

DRAWLINE(CURRBARSCOUNT=QADH,QHL2,CURRBARSCOUNT=XZDD,QHL1,0)de color;